The conclusion of this series covering the Fischoff Competition, including a summary of some of my favorite takeaways, tips, and advice, and with a conversation with my fellow podcaster friend, Nathan Cole, on what it was like for us there!   CONGRATULATIONS TO THE WINNERS OF THE 46TH FISCHOFF NATIONAL CHAMBER MUSIC COMPETITION   Grand Prize Aruna Quartet – Texas Tech University Senior Division Strings/Piano Gold Medal Winner: Merz Trio – New York City Silver Medal Winner: Abeo Quartet – Juilliard School Bronze Medal Winner: Dior Quartet – Indiana University ; Jacobs School Senior Division Winds/Brass Gold Medal Winner: Aruna Quartet – Texas Tech University Silver Medal Winner: Khroma Quartet – University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ign Bronze Medal Winner: Catharsis Winds – Cleveland Institute  Junior Division Strings/Piano Gold Medal Winner: Fervida Trio – Young Chamber Musicians, Burlingame CA Silver Medal Winner: Éclatante String Quartet – Starling Preparatory String Project, Cincinnati OH Bronze Medal Winner: Meraki Quartet – Crowden Music Center, Berkeley CA Junior Division Winds/Brass Gold Medal Winner: Golden Melody Saxophone Quartet – Middle School of the Central Conservatory of Music in Beijing, China Silver Medal Winner: Quantum Quartet – Hebron High School, Carrollton Texas Bronze Medal Winner: The Bone Rangers – Merit School of Music     Fischoff National Chamber Music Competition: https://www.fischoff.org/ Instagram: https://www.instagram.com/fischoffchambermusic/ Facebook: https://www.facebook.com/TheFischoff/   Nathan Cole: https://www.natesviolin.com/ Stand Partners for Life: https://www.natesviolin.com/the-stand-partners-for-life-podcast/     If you enjoyed the show, please leave a review on iTunes!  I truly appreciate your support!
